Latest Patents

Kogure's latest innovations showcase his focus on enhancing information processing systems. One notable patent outlines an information processing system and apparatus that manages combined applications executed by an image processing apparatus. This system efficiently categorizes and distinguishes various applications using corresponding identifiers.

Another significant patent presents a method for controlling an information processing apparatus that determines if an extended application can reuse a virtual machine (VM). This technology enables more efficient resource management in computing environments, making it easier to execute applications by optimizing the use of VMs held in a ready state.
